Aiming at the problem of low control precision and small applicable scope caused by adjusting control parameters in Ziegler-Nichols (ZN) method, a parameter tuning method based on Worm algorithm (WOA) is proposed for Brushless DC motor. Firstly, the model of speed control is established by proportional integral method for Brushless DC motor with two - phase conduction and three - phase full bridge drive. Then the fitness function of the controller is constructed by the Integral Absolute Error (IAE). Finally, the early optimization process, the later movement rule and the peak extraction rule are determined for WOA, and the controller parameter tuning process is designed. Simulation results under constant and sinusoidal conditions show the effectiveness of the proposed method. WOA was compared with ZN, genetic algorithm (GA), differential evolution algorithm (DE) and particle swarm optimization algorithm (PSO) in the experiment. The experimental results show that the control effect (CE) of WOA under uniform speed has been improved by 2.56% on average, and has been improved by 16.93% on average under sinusoidal speed. Compared with previous methods, this method can be used for parameter adjustment of complex control with higher control precision.
scite is a Brooklyn-based organization that helps researchers better discover and understand research articles through Smart Citations–citations that display the context of the citation and describe whether the article provides supporting or contrasting evidence. scite is used by students and researchers from around the world and is funded in part by the National Science Foundation and the National Institute on Drug Abuse of the National Institutes of Health.
customersupport@researchsolutions.com
10624 S. Eastern Ave., Ste. A-614
Henderson, NV 89052, USA
Copyright © 2024 scite LLC. All rights reserved.
Made with 💙 for researchers
Part of the Research Solutions Family.